The Unique Appeal of Raja Ampat

Raja Ampat is made up of hundreds of islands scattered across turquoise waters in West Papua. The area is globally recognized for having one of the richest marine ecosystems on Earth. Coral reefs here support thousands of fish species, vibrant soft corals, and rare marine life that divers travel across the globe to see.

A Raja Ampat dive lodge allows visitors to stay close to these natural wonders, often right on the shoreline or above the water itself.

Marine Biodiversity

Divers can expect encounters with reef sharks, manta rays, sea turtles, and massive schools of fish.

Macro lovers will enjoy spotting pygmy seahorses, nudibranchs, and rare critters.

Travel and Accessibility

Reaching a Raja Ampat dive lodge requires some planning, but the journey is part of the adventure.

Travel usually involves flights to Sorong, followed by a boat transfer to the lodge.
